Flexographic printing machines are widely used in various industries due to their cost-effectiveness, versatility, and high-quality printing results. Training your team on how to operate these machines effectively is crucial to maximize their productivity, reduce errors, and maintain the longevity of the equipment. This comprehensive guide will provide you with detailed insights into effective training strategies for your flexo printing team.
Establish a Training Plan
– Identify Training Needs: Assess the current skills and knowledge of your team. Determine the specific areas where training is required, such as machine operation, maintenance, and quality control.
– Set Training Objectives: Clearly define the goals for the training program. This will guide the development of the curriculum and ensure that the training meets the intended objectives.
– Develop a Curriculum: Structure the training program into logical modules, covering all essential aspects of flexo printing. Include both theoretical and practical sessions to provide a well-rounded understanding.
– Provide Training Materials: Collect and prepare training materials such as manuals, videos, and diagrams to support the learning process. Ensure that the materials are clear, concise, and relevant to the training objectives.
Conduct Effective Training Sessions
– Theoretical Training: Deliver the theoretical knowledge through classroom sessions or online platforms. Explain the principles of flexo printing, machine components, and operating procedures.
– Practical Training: Provide hands-on experience by allowing the team to operate the machines under supervision. Guide them through each step of the printing process, demonstrating proper techniques and safety procedures.
– Simulator Training: Utilize advanced simulators to create a realistic training environment. This allows the team to practice machine operation and troubleshooting without the risk of damaging the actual equipment.
– Assessment and Feedback: Regularly assess the team’s understanding through quizzes, tests, and performance evaluations. Provide constructive feedback to identify areas that need improvement.
Ensure Continuous Training and Support
– Ongoing Training: Continuously update the training program as new techniques and technologies emerge. Provide refresher courses to reinforce knowledge and keep the team abreast of best practices.
– Technical Support: Establish a support system to assist the team with machine troubleshooting, problem-solving, and maintenance issues. Provide resources such as technical manuals, troubleshooting guides, and access to expert assistance.
– Knowledge Sharing: Encourage the team to share knowledge and experiences through regular meetings, forums, or online platforms. This fosters a collaborative learning environment and promotes continuous improvement.
Measure and Evaluate Success
– Performance Tracking: Monitor the team’s performance through production rates, quality control metrics, and machine downtime. This data can provide insights into the effectiveness of the training program.
– Feedback from Operators: Regularly gather feedback from the team to assess their understanding, identify areas for improvement, and ensure that the training meets their needs.
– Return on Investment (ROI): Calculate the ROI of the training program by considering increased productivity, reduced waste, and improved quality. This evaluation helps justify the investment in training and demonstrate its value to the organization.
